Output 66e61cea2972e71a52d3a7b373fd767bb4698e21c7267b22327ee5afe166dc78:0

value
29654200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a9337dcffbda4b6a05fae2ef1f82ea23c0e23e3b OP_EQUALVERIFY OP_CHECKSIG
address
1GRet7HU9jrYPjKhZyraaXgL9KxtiyEZDS
transaction
66e61cea2972e71a52d3a7b373fd767bb4698e21c7267b22327ee5afe166dc78
spent
true